Tennis great Rafael Nadal has continued his fine start to 2017 with a comfortable victory over Jack Sock in the quarter-final of the Miami Open to set up a last-4 clash with Fabio Fognini.

The Spaniard made light work of the American, who was a break up at the start of the second set, winning 6-2 6-3 to secure his place in the semi-finals.

To battle him in the next round is Italian Fognini, the only remaining unseeded player in the draw, who stunned second seed Kei Nishikori.

“I know him very well and he knows me very well,” Nadal said after his win over Sock.

“We played a few times and he’s beaten me a couple of times, too. It’s a tough match.

“He’s playing well, so it will be a good challenge. I need to play my best, keep playing aggressive like I did today and hope to have my chances.”

Nadal’s semi-final clash with Fognini will take place Friday.
